Entry-Level Career Progression
This comparison is typical for early career moves or first promotions. At this salary range, most of your income is taxed at the basic rate (20%), so you keep a higher percentage of any raise.
- Negotiate hard - you keep ~70-80% of any increase at this level
- Consider employers offering good pension matching (often worth more than small salary differences)
- Look for roles with clear progression paths to higher bands
- Factor in benefits like free lunches, gym memberships, or transport subsidies

Comparison Results
| Metric | £13,504 | £37,101 |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| £13,504 | £37,101 | £23,597 |
| Income Tax | £187 | £4,906 | £4,719 |
| National Insurance | £75 | £1,962 | £1,888 |
| Pension | £0 | £0 | £0 |
| Take-Home Pay (Yearly) | £13,242 | £30,232 | £16,990 |
| Take-Home (Monthly) | £1,104 | £2,519 | £1,416 |
| Effective Tax Rate | 1.9% | 18.5% | 16.6% |
